Scenario Analysis - ANSWERSMultiple inputs changed at once.
A story (or "scenario") about the future.
Typically represents several business cases.
Scenarios will be compared and risks weighted.
Sensitivity Analysis - ANSWERSOne assumption changed at a time.
No story about why inputs go up or down.
Used to determine which assumptions matter most.
A form of risk assessment where drivers are compared individually.
